Searched refs:PostOrderRefSCCs (Results 1 – 2 of 2) sorted by relevance
| /freebsd/contrib/llvm-project/llvm/lib/Analysis/ |
| H A D | LazyCallGraph.cpp | 1044 for (RefSCC *C : make_range(G->PostOrderRefSCCs.begin() + SourceIdx + 1, in insertIncomingRefEdge() 1045 G->PostOrderRefSCCs.begin() + TargetIdx + 1)) in insertIncomingRefEdge() 1080 SourceC, *this, G->PostOrderRefSCCs, G->RefSCCIndices, in insertIncomingRefEdge() 1130 G->PostOrderRefSCCs.erase(MergeRange.begin(), MergeRange.end()); in insertIncomingRefEdge() 1131 for (RefSCC *RC : make_range(EraseEnd, G->PostOrderRefSCCs.end())) in insertIncomingRefEdge() 1353 G->PostOrderRefSCCs.erase(G->PostOrderRefSCCs.begin() + Idx); in removeInternalRefEdges() 1354 G->PostOrderRefSCCs.insert(G->PostOrderRefSCCs.begin() + Idx, Result.begin(), in removeInternalRefEdges() 1356 for (int I : seq<int>(Idx, G->PostOrderRefSCCs.size())) in removeInternalRefEdges() 1357 G->RefSCCIndices[G->PostOrderRefSCCs[I]] = I; in removeInternalRefEdges() 1689 PostOrderRefSCCs.insert(PostOrderRefSCCs.begin() + OriginalRCIndex, NewRC); in addSplitFunction() [all …]
|
| /freebsd/contrib/llvm-project/llvm/include/llvm/Analysis/ |
| H A D | LazyCallGraph.h | 902 if (Index == (int)G.PostOrderRefSCCs.size()) in getRC() 906 return G.PostOrderRefSCCs[Index]; in getRC() 961 assert(!PostOrderRefSCCs.empty() && in postorder_ref_scc_begin() 967 assert(!PostOrderRefSCCs.empty() && in postorder_ref_scc_end() 1146 SmallVector<RefSCC *, 16> PostOrderRefSCCs; variable 1210 assert(PostOrderRefSCCs[IndexIt->second] == &RC && in getRefSCCIndex()
|